After working hard all summer when the Autumn arrives and the crops are gathered after paying debts necessarily incurred have not a sufficiency left to support their families until the next spring, which finds them poorer than before. How long will such a state of things exist? Is there no remedy? Must this unfortunate people after all the government has done be kept in nominal servitude by these rebel lordlings? Steps I think should be taken and that speedily to remedy these things and to make them remember that Lee surrendered at Appamattox that they must observe the paroles, then taken or be branded as perjured villains, unworthy the protection of the government or the notice of loyal men should these miserable creatures be allowed to persist in their lawless course in a very short time loyalty will have no possible chance in King George County. It has been reported that in a short time the the so called Yankees will be invited to leave the County as they "have no use for Yankees and Carpet Baggers" amongst them these "noble high minded Virginia Gentlemen".
